Major Update: New B.Pharm Syllabus Implementation (NEP 2020) – Effective 2026-27

Brief Information: The Pharmacy Council of India (PCI) has officially released the revised Bachelor of Pharmacy (B.Pharm) syllabus, aligned with the National Education Policy (NEP) 2020. This modernized curriculum introduces emerging fields such as Artificial Intelligence (AI), Python Programming, and Machine Learning into the core pharmaceutical sciences. The new regulations will be implemented from the Academic Year 2026–27.

I. Important Notification Dates

Key Implementation Timeline
Syllabus Revision Year 2025 (Revised Regulations)
Implementation Session Academic Year 2026–2027
Program Duration 8 Semesters (4 Years) / 6 Semesters (Lateral Entry)
Minimum Credit Requirement 193 Credit Points

II. Eligibility for Admission

1. First Year B.Pharm

  • Candidate must have passed 10+2 examination conducted by Central/State Government authorities.
  • Compulsory Subjects: English, Physics, and Chemistry.
  • Optional Subjects: Mathematics or Biology.
  • Any other qualification approved by PCI as equivalent to the above.

2. Lateral Entry (To Third Semester)

  • Candidates must have passed D.Pharm from a PCI-approved institution under section 12 of the Pharmacy Act.
  • Lateral entry students must complete Bridge Courses: Healthcare Psychology and Python Programming (Sem III) and Applied Biostatistics (Sem IV).

III. New Emerging Subjects Introduced

To meet the needs of the modern pharmaceutical industry, PCI has integrated Digital Technologies into the curriculum:

Semester Course Code Course Name (New Technology Oriented) Credit
Semester I BP101T Basics of Python Programming for Pharma Sciences 02
Semester II BP201T Applied Biostatistics and Data Analytics 02
Semester III BP301T Introduction to Machine Learning in Pharma Sciences 02
Semester VI BP604T AI Applications in Pharmaceutical Sciences 02
Semester VII BP703T AI in Clinical Applications 02
Semester VIII BP801T Ethical Considerations and Translational AI in Pharmacy 02

IV. Credit Structure (Semester-Wise)

Semester I II III IV V VI VII VIII Total Credits
Total Credits 21 26 25 23 22 26 26 24 193

V. Key Changes & Features

  • NEP 2020 Alignment: Focus on skill-based education and research orientation.
  • Mandatory Internship: 120 hours of industrial/hospital/clinical research training after Sem V & VI.
  • Choice Based Credit System (CBCS): Flexibility to choose Elective Courses in Sem VI, VII, and VIII.
  • Research Project: Supervised research projects introduced in the final year (Sem VII & VIII).
  • Attendance: Minimum 75% attendance is mandatory for both Theory and Practical components separately.
